Outsourced IT: A Smart Financial Move for Stuart Businesses
Stuart businesses, from the historic bustling storefronts on Colorado Avenue to the professional offices near the historic courthouse, are increasingly looking for ways to optimize their operations and bottom line. One area gaining significant traction is the outsourcing of Information Technology (IT) services, a strategy that offers notable financial benefits for companies of all sizes.
For many local businesses, maintaining an in-house IT department can be a substantial expense. This often includes salaries for IT staff, benefits packages, ongoing training to keep up with rapidly evolving technology, and the cost of purchasing and maintaining specialized software and hardware. By outsourcing IT, businesses can convert these often unpredictable and high fixed costs into more manageable, predictable operational expenses.
Local entrepreneurs frequently cite cost savings as a primary driver. Instead of a full-time salary, businesses can pay a fixed monthly fee for comprehensive IT support, which can include everything from network management and cybersecurity to data backup and help desk services. This allows for better budget forecasting and frees up capital that can be reinvested into core business activities, such as expanding product lines or enhancing customer service.
Furthermore, outsourced IT providers bring a depth of expertise that a small or medium-sized business might struggle to afford internally. These firms typically employ a team of specialists with diverse skills, ensuring that businesses have access to cutting-edge solutions and immediate support for a wide range of technical issues. This specialized knowledge can prevent costly downtime and improve overall efficiency, directly impacting profitability.
The flexibility offered by outsourced IT is another key advantage. As businesses grow or face seasonal fluctuations, their IT needs can change. Outsourcing allows companies to scale services up or down as required, avoiding the expense and hassle of hiring or laying off staff. This adaptability is particularly valuable in Stuart's dynamic business environment.
Ultimately, for many Stuart businesses, outsourcing IT isn't just about cutting costs; it's about strategic financial management that enhances operational efficiency, reduces risk, and allows local companies to focus on what they do best, contributing to the economic vitality of our waterfront community.
